Frequently Asked Questions about Schaumburg

How much are Studio apartments in Schaumburg?

There are currently 43 Studio Apartments in Schaumburg with rent ranges from $1,150 to $6,000 with an average price of $1,897.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Schaumburg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Schaumburg ranges from $1,195 to $3,278 with an average monthly rent of $1,854.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Schaumburg c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Schaumburg range from $1,495 to $4,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,225.

How expensive are Schaumburg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 23 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Schaumburg on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,920 to $12,203 - averaging $3,694 for the location.
